Output d2687631dedfb320f5c5e6e8511ab891ecff2e6c9fc925496d598cf73b04621a:25

value
228863
script pubkey
OP_0 OP_PUSHBYTES_20 65ede7ff97e899c0c002b8bc9c17ee869d3023cb
address
bc1qvhk70luhazvupsqzhz7fc9lws6wnqg7tq4sz57
transaction
d2687631dedfb320f5c5e6e8511ab891ecff2e6c9fc925496d598cf73b04621a